Apprécier Meaning, Pronunciation and Examples
📘 Apprécier meaning
Apprécier is a French verb that literally means “to appreciate.” However, it also carries a deeper nuance — “to like” or “to enjoy” something in a thoughtful, discerning way. It suggests taste, personal judgment, and genuine value. Thus, its meaning can change slightly depending on context. For example, J’apprécie vos paroles aimables means “I appreciate your kind words,” while J’apprécie l’art moderne means “I like modern art.”
🎧 Apprécier pronunciation
The pronunciation of apprécier is /apʁesje/, which sounds like ah-preh-syay.
📝 Apprécier examples & usages
J’apprécie la cuisine française, surtout la ratatouille.
I enjoy French cuisine, especially ratatouille.
J’apprécie beaucoup la musique classique.
I really like classical music.
Avec le temps, j’ai appris à apprécier le jazz.
Over time, I’ve learned to like jazz.
Elle apprécie la simplicité de ce tableau.
She likes the simplicity of this painting.
❤️ J’apprécie vs. Je suis reconnaissant
For expressing gratitude toward someone, you can naturally use both j’apprécie (I appreciate) and je suis reconnaissant(e) (I’m grateful).
➔ J’apprécie votre gentillesse. I appreciate your kindness.
➔ Je vous suis reconnaissant(e) pour votre gentillesse. I am grateful for your kindness.

📊 Apprécier conjugation
Here’s the basic apprécier conjugation in the present tense.
- J’apprécie — I appreciate (I’m appreciating, I do appreciate)
- Tu apprécies — You appreciate (informal)
- Il / Elle apprécie — He / She appreciates
- Nous apprécions — We appreciate
- Vous appréciez — You appreciate
- Ils / Elles apprécient — They appreciate

🔗 Related words and expressions
- être reconnaissant — to be grateful/thankful
- j’apprécie beaucoup — I really appreciate it
- aimer — to like, to love
- adorer — to love, to adore
- merci — thank you
- savourer — to savor, to relish, to enjoy fully
- l’estime — esteem, respect, high regard
